DuPont gunpowder mills on the Brandywine Creek

E428497

The DuPont gunpowder mills on the Brandywine Creek were an early 19th-century American industrial complex that became one of the nation’s leading producers of gunpowder and the foundation of the DuPont company’s industrial empire.
